    How do i complain to the landowner?

    well for starters read post #24 here https://forums.moneysavingexpert.com/discussion/4833321

    so finding out landowner details is never easy, but you could do an online request to the land registry , pay your £2.50p or whatever it is and ask them

    check if your PCN lists the creditor

    then read your NTK as it will list the creditor (when it arrives)

    but one reason I mentioned the word SHOP is because they should know who the landowner is, and you wont be the first to have had a pcn so the shop manager should know the ropes

    the thing is that you need to learn to think "outside the box" and learn to be pro-active , seeking all avenues of redress

    ie:- do some research etc

    so to answer you exact question , I would complain to the shop, and ask them whilst doing so , even if its their head office or their CEO

    after all, IF the landowner was the shop, then clearly your complaint is with them
